Step One
Quote Request Plus Site Walk Confirmation
We request two or three photos of the drop zone before delivery is finalized to ensure the truck has enough clearance. During our site walk-through, we assist you as you pick a standard porta potty unit type, an ada stall, or a trailer. We verify the placement to guarantee safe access.

Step Two
Delivery Day Logistics for Restroom Placement
On delivery day, our flatbed driver arrives within a two-hour window, texts ahead to confirm entry and confirm at least twelve feet of overhead clearance, and rolls out with the lift gate. He levels each royal blue HDPE unit on a firm surface, sets it with the door facing away from the prevailing wind, then stocks it with toilet paper, hand sanitizer, and a fresh deodorizer charge before leaving.

Servicing Cadence Through End-of-Rental Pickup
Once your unit is on site, our vacuum truck runs a weekly route by default. We perform a thorough pump out of the holding tank using a suction hose to clear the waste tank and grey water. Every visit includes a restock of paper and sanitizer along with a wipe-down of high-touch surfaces. Heavier-use sites can scale up to twice-weekly or daily service. We maintain a paper trail where every visit is logged with date, technician, and notes. Customers can verify portable toilet rental service area in Portland.
When you're ready to wrap your rental, two business days of notice lets us swing back with the same flatbed that delivered it. We retrieve the porta potty, document disposal practices per ANSI Z4.3, and leave the site clean. Frequently Asked Questions
+ How fast can I get a quote?
Most quotes go out the same business day. A morning call usually receives pricing before lunch, while an afternoon call lands by end of day. Complex events requiring a luxury restroom trailer may need an extra day if we have to perform a site walk first.
+ What does the driver need on delivery day?
You need a flat, firm surface, twelve feet of overhead clearance, and enough space to set the unit without blocking traffic. If the drop spot is behind a locked gate, provide the gate code or a contact name in advance. See our access and delivery requirements page for more details.
+ How often will the unit be serviced?
Standard cadence is once weekly for a jobsite of about ten workers using a single unit. High-traffic sites and event weekends scale up to twice-weekly or daily service. This schedule can be adjusted mid-rental if the restroom usage changes during the project.
+ How much notice do you need to schedule pickup?
Forty-eight hours of notice is the sweet spot for end-of-rental pickup. While we may swing back through the area for same-day removal, providing notice by two days will guarantee a clean pickup window that fits in with your timeline and ensures we wrap up the service on time.
